John Dow Posted September 20, 2016 Share Posted September 20, 2016 There might be a solution for you. I don't think the lack of a control panel matters if you intend to keep the AU AI traffic. The install routine disables the default traffic, and enables FTX AI International, FTX AI Aust and NZ, and FTX AI GA Traffic. The control panel is only required to return to the default traffic. You should have in your Scenery\World\Scenery folder some Traffic_FTX_ xxx files. If so, i FSX you sould be seeing the FTX AI traffic at the Australian airports. If you need to return to default traffic post here again and we should be able to get you back to square one.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
